This book is packed with ideas, build instructions and some very clever, beautiful and on occasions completely bizarre examples. I have to say a few of the examples are just plain weird but the ideas are great and to be fair most of the examples are outstanding.
A lot of the ideas in here, if you've been making books for a while, will not be new to you however the way they have been applied maybe. It's a book of pure inspiration, magic projects and great colour pictures, which I prefer to use to work out how the book has been created rather than read the instructions.
The project instructions give you a rough make time (their idea of 45 minutes and mine are slightly different), a list of materials, sizes, tools, etc and written instructions on how to make the project. There are also diagrams to help along the way. The written instructions are absolutely fine but I found the diagrams gave me all I needed to know when I needed a prompt.
Get this book if your skills as a book maker are at intermediate levels and above. If you are an absolute beginner and what to see what you can be doing after mastering a few of the basic skills, buy this book. If you just like to see another person's take on accordion, stitch bound, origami pockets books and boxes to put them in to, go no further.
